Blasting on Highway

Caption says, "A-271 Blasting on highway cut, Station 66+50. 1,700 pounds of 60% gelatin powder were used in 107 holes of an average depth of 16 feet. Firing order: holes grouped in 21, 36, and 50. Picture taken from rock point northwest of Station 66+50."
